#4e11b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e11b9 is composed of 30.6% red, 6.7%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.8% cyan, 90.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 261.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 39.6%. #4e11b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#9c22ff with #000073.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#4e11b9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e11b9 has RGB values of R:78, G:17,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5116345.

Shades and Tints of #4e11b9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020005 is the darkest color, while #f7f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e11b9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635f6b is the less saturated color, while #4a01c9 is the most saturated one.
